QURGHON TEPPA, December 11, 2013, Asia-Plus — A military court of the Khatlon garrison has sentenced Atajon Nazhbuddinov, an officer at the State Committee for National Security (SCNS)’s office in the Gorno Badakhshan Autonomous Region (GBAO), to payment of a fine for setting fire to his mother’s house in Khatlon’s Vakhsh district.

“Atajon Nazhbuddinov, who is from the Vakhsh district by origin, faced charges under the provisions of two articles of Tajikistan’s Penal Code: Article 255 (2) – deliberate destruction or damage of property; and Article 329 – threat against law enforcement officers and military personnel,” the Khatlon military court chairman Toir Iskandarov told Asia-Plus in an interview.

According to him, Atajon Nazhbuddinov being in a state of drunkenness set fire to his mother’s house in the Vahdat jamoat of the Vakhsh district in Khatlon on August 6, 2013.  Damage caused by the fire was estimated at 3,000 somoni.

“Besides, Nazhbuddinov insulted firefighters who came to extinguish the fire,” Iskandarov said, noting that under the ruling handed down by the court should pay an 8,000 somoni fine.
